    starting to piece together a twin turbo SBC setup in a 73 Camaro, setup so far 350 +040 9:1 compression NXE274H cam, World Sportsman II heads with port work, Victor Junior intake, CSU 750 Blow through carb with CSU hat, A1000 pump and reg with -8 feed and -10 return lines, ICE ignition with Map sensor and adjustable boost retard. Going with 2 x Borgwarner S366 turbos with .88 single scroll exhaust side.
    My question is Where do I run the Water Meth Injection jet ? close to each turbo outlet or at the merge form two to one ?

    I always did right at the throttle. Not sure on a blow through.

    If you have 2 nozzles and they are the same jet I'd go pre turbo if you don't have an inter cooler.......or like you said in the outlet tube on the charge pipes from the turbo....it needs a chance to mix a lil before the carb sees it if you understand what I'm saying.....pre turbo cools the turbo and air at the source of the heat

    Not a fan of pre turbo unless its a very small jet used for a little cooling.


    What is your power goal and fuel choice?

    Thought that water methanol hurts the impellors of the turbo so that rules pre turbo out.
    Have mine fited in the carb hat inline with the turbo intake. Just at the bottom so its out of sight.
